Winchester House School

Winchester House School was founded in 1875 and moved to its present 18-acre site in the centre of Brackley in 1922.

The heart of the School is situated in Manor House, an attractive building dating from the early 1800s.

Winchester House comprises a fully co-educational nursery, pre-prep and preparatory school, offering an outstanding education to children aged 3-13 with day, occasional and weekly boarding available.

In January 2021, Winchester House School became part of The Stowe Group.
